      Set your tunnel network to anything else than 10.0.0.0/8 because your LAN is eating all the space for this network.
      Just use something like 192.168.123.0/24 for the tunnel. But stay in RFC1918 space!!
      I'd recommend to renumber your LAN to something realistic...

                      Yeah, MS messes up a lot of things. Classful addresses went out years ago. As for VPNs and other point to point connections, you can use /31, though some systems (MS again) require /30. Even on IPv6, with gazillions of addresses, a /127 is recommended.
